Greetings, and welcome to my traditional end of the season forecast.
The trick today will be finding wind without rain and air warm enough to enjoy.
Best bet today is Sulfur Creek for steady 7M sails all day, but clouds possible rain, and cold 50 degree
air may be your season swan song up there. UL might pump up some NW 7/14 around Noon
for a couple of hours today with air temps near 60, and maybe a sun peek or 2, could be a little rain also.

Tomorrow, sunnier conditions and better 7/14M NW wind at UL launches PM.

Weds, does not look windy.
